Cape Town - Former Kaizer Chiefs defender Fabian McCarthy believes another trophyless season for Steve Komphela would spell the end of his reign at the club.
Komphela will be under immense pressure to deliver silverware in the upcoming season after a difficult first season in charge.
Chiefs lost both MTN8 and Telkom Knockout finals and only managed a fifth place finish in the Premiership.
"Chiefs has shown a lot of faith in Komphela in his first season and he should repay them," McCarthy told KickOff.
"I mean Komphela's got the personnel and players he wanted to compete for honours. There is no time for excuses and it's time to deliver.
"I'm not entirely sure about what is referred to as the Chiefs way, but I'm thinking it's not only the brand of attacking football but the success he needs to bring to the club again.
"The fans have been longing for total dominance like former teams in the past. It won't be easy and the pressure will be on. It is definitely going to be an interesting season that lies ahead."
